Adult Education benefit BBQ Aug. 15

Adult Community Education (ACE) will hold its Annual Pulled Pork BBQ Dinner from 3:00 to 6:00 p.m. Saturday, Aug. 15. Enjoy delicious smoked pulled pork, homemade sides of mac and cheese, slaw and baked beans, plus wonderful homemade desserts. The dinner will take place at Mineral United Methodist Church, 301 W Third Street, Mineral. Get your tickets now from the ACE office in the Sage Building (115 Jefferson Highway, Louisa), call 540-967-5660, call Susan Fletcher at 540-223-1017, or call any ACE Board member.

Arts Center’s Music and Wine returns Friday

Louisa Arts Center’s Music and Wine series is back this Friday, Aug. 7! Enjoy this free outdoor performance on the terrace, as local musicians provide entertainment. The event takes place one Friday of each summer month from 6:00 to 8:00 p.m. Beer, wine and soft drinks are available for purchase, and the center encourages attendees to order carry-out from restaurants within Louisa. Bring your lawn chairs, a picnic basket, and be ready for a fun-filled evening perfect for the entire family!
